– 2021 Lakes at Litchfield Supernova Winner –

The Supernova Award is the highest individual honor that our company gives and each year. One individual on the leadership team at The Lakes at Litchfield is voted by their colleagues as the community’s Supernova based on an assortment of criteria. Each year during the Senior Living Communities Annual Meeting, the winner is revealed and given a customized crystal award at the company’s formal Supernova Awards Evening. The criteria for voting is based on upholding our company’s mission to be caring professionals dedicated to quality services. Additionally, this individual will consistently deliver excellent customer service (to Members, families, and colleagues), lead positively with integrity, take accountability, put the team before themselves, and embody the company’s vision to create communities where people live longer, healthier, and happier lives.

This year, we are proud to congratulate our Lifestyle Advisor, Jamie Prosser, as the recipient of the 2021 Supernova Award. This honor was bestowed at the Senior Living Communities Annual Meeting on Thursday, August 5th at the Omni Amelia Island Plantation on Amelia Island, Florida. As a Lifestyle Advisor, Jamie is a knowledgeable and detailed-oriented professional who guides prospective Members through the community’s residential options in an expedient way. She also serves as a key marketing contact for their campus in the greater community.

Jamie began her career working in the engineering industry for a company that designed bridges and specialized in transportation. Prior to coming to The Lakes, she was Assistant Head of School at Lowcountry Preparatory School, spent several years as a private consultant to three different companies, and a couple of retail businesses. Additionally, she served as the Chairman for the March of Dimes Chef Auction and Board Member for many organizations including the Grand Strand Miracle League.

In her free time, Jaime enjoys college sports and you can catch her cheering on the Georgia Bulldogs. Additionally, she enjoys cooking, needlepoint and spending time with beloved Maltese, Zoe. She’s a proud mother of Matthew and Thomas who are currently in college.
